Description

Esther has always been an average student. She coasts through life on a sea of Bs, until a fatal mistake jolts her out of mediocrity and into something else entirely. She accidentally leaves a story in an essay for her teacher - one that no teacher should ever see. And especially not Professor Halstrom. His lectures are legendary, and he is formidable. But most of all: he is devastatingly handsome, and now he has Esther's most private and erotic fantasies. The stage is set for humiliation. Until the Professor presents her with a choice. He offers private tuition at his home. And at first that's exactly what she does, sure there remains a line between teacher and student that she would never cross it and that someone like Halstrom never would. He is far too cold and sharp, and so invested in all of his rules that breaking them seems unthinkable.
